RE: AOS BMW and SERMI
Dear AOS-Users,
we would like to inform you that the SERMI scheme is mandatory for users from the following countries starting April 1st: Austria (new) Belgium (new) Germany (new) Luxembourg (new) The Netherlands (new) Portugal (new) Spain (new) Norway Denmark Finland Sweden It will be all Eu countries for all oem brands eventually |

RE: AOS BMW and SERMI
(10-04-2024, 16:32 PM)Fx82 Wrote: For what do you need this exactly? Good question. I flashed one E- series yesterday and everything went well. I Read fault codes, no problem. After I run one ABL (LIN bus failure related) in ABL schematic I tried to open one connection, then that QR-code thing popped out (cannot continue further). I sent a message to helpdesk and they claimed that I can continue working as normal and there will be no restrictions. Nope!. I replied but I haven't got any real answer yet. I flash customers cars only with AOS, so to me that's the only one, I must to have. For diagnosting & coding i can live with BU & BMWTools & Rheingold etc. SERMI is actually good for small shops who like to separate them from "half criminal" tax cheater etc companies. I can have that sertificate, no problem, but is a bit too expencive as my business is so low anymore. |
